    We’re Jenna Haufler and Miguel Mattox-
    With humble roots as college swimmers, we’ve worked hard to become two of the country’s leading age-group triathletes, and are now on a mission to become professional athletes while still having fun along the way. We swim-bike-run together, eat together, sleep together, and make videos together for our own (and hopefully your) enjoyment.
    Throughout our documented journey, watch how a couple of ambitious 20-something-year-olds work towards their life goals in a disciplined yet untraditional, not-so-serious manner.
    We live for adventure and hope to inspire our viewers and subscribers to seek out the same.

    I feel so bad for you. I am 52 and had never had foot or any injury problems my entire life until doing the 70.3 in Hawaii last year. Did it in some Nike Alphafly which I had only used for a few short runs prior. After the race my foot really hurt but never having to deal with this, didn’t know what it was. I thought I had just stepped on a rock or something. After a couple more days of vacation it felt like a 1000 degree ice pick stabbing into my heal. I thought this isn’t right and did some research to find out it was planter fasciitis. One Dr visit and about 4 months of night braces and stretching and all the other recommended things and I was about 50% better, 9 months and I was 90% better and right about the weekend the race happened this year I realized I no longer feel anything. It’s a really bad injury to work through. Wishing you lots of luck with your recovery.
